Peters Prairie Vineyard

Located right on the courtyard square in Mason is Peters Prairie Vineyard owned by Curt and Kim Pipkin Henderson. They also own the vineyard of the same name that is located outside of Mason. The vineyard has gone through a few hands over the years and the Hendersons picked it up in 2018.

The winery just opened in April and we visited it during our recent trip to Mason. The tasting room is a beautifully remodeled store with a lot of room inside. We met co-owner Kim and she let us select where we wanted to sit so we chose a nice area in the rear corner with a couch and chairs to begin a comfortable tasting.

These are the wines that were available at the time of our visit:

  • 2020 Pinot Grigio – Peters Prairie Vineyard, Mason County
  • 2019 Barbera – Peters Prairie Vineyard, Mason County
  • 2019 Tempranillo – Tallent Vineyards, Mason County
  • 2019 Malbec – Peters Prairie Vineyard, Mason County
  • 2019 Syrah – Peters Prairie Vineyard, Mason County

As you can see, all the wines are from their vineyard except for the Tempranillo. They currently use a custom crush facility to make their wines and they all are excellent.
